AMD Radeon R9 280X | vs | AMD Radeon RX Vega 56 |
---|---|---|
Oct 8th, 2013 | Release Date | Aug 14th, 2017 |
Volcanic Islands | Generation | Vega |
$299 | MSRP | $399 |
2x DVI, 1x HDMI, 1x DisplayPort | Outputs | 1x HDMI, 3x DisplayPort |
1x 6-pin + 1x 8-pin | Power Connectors | 2x 8-pin |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
3 GB | Memory | 8 GB |
GDDR5 | Type | HBM2 |
384-bit | Bus | 2048-bit |
288 GB/s | Bandwidth | 409.6 GB/s |
850 MHz | Base Clock Speed | 1156 MHz |
1000 MHz | Boost Clock Speed | 1471 MHz |
1500 MHz | Memory Clock Speed | 800 MHz |
